This product is designed for students who struggle with social interaction. Much of what we communicate to others is shared through non-verbal language (body language, facial expression, gestures). Many students who struggle socially may understand the meaning of non-verbal language, BUT struggle to pay attention to and respond to them in the moment of a conversation.
